Abstract
In an aspect of the disclosure, a method, a computer-readable medium, and an apparatus for assigning feature colors for a multiple patterning process are provided. The apparatus receives integrated circuit layout information including a set of features and an assigned color of a plurality of colors for each feature of a first subset of features of the set of features. In addition, the apparatus performs color decomposition on a second subset of features to assign colors to features in the second subset of features. The second subset of features includes features in the set of features that are not included in the first subset of features with an assigned color.
